Transaction 98c7ea231204d307490202f5f206de80d603ddb0b7b9627545d7c99864822906
1 Input
1 Output
-
98c7ea231204d307490202f5f206de80d603ddb0b7b9627545d7c99864822906:0
- value
- 685350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03a3fc320f399a7876d82a518cf5bc0f7efbe151 OP_EQUAL
- address
- 322GQ1KvG1XRBfDv5BhrLxZkxrPq1BFQ9N